This Chinese Crested: Your Info

The adorable Chinese Crested is a small breed recognized for its distinctive appearance. These dogs come in two main varieties: the completely hairless and the coated variety. The hairless/powderpuff type boasts smooth skin aside from tufts of hair on the head and toes, and a flowing tail. Conversely , the fluffy Chinese Crested has a complete coat of fine fur. Hailing from China, despite their precise history remains relatively unclear, they were historically used as ratters on trade ships . Nowadays , they serve as lovely friends and excel in competitions .

Chinese Crested Dog: Temperament , Upkeep, and Health

The Chinese Crested dog is known for its unique style and friendly temperament . These little pals are typically loving with their households, often forming deep connections and exhibiting a energetic nature. Grooming requirements differ considerably depending on whether you have a smooth or powderpuff variety; the smooth type needs minimal brushing, while the coated variety needs regular combing . Possible medical concerns encompass ocular problems, dermal allergies , and limb ailments, so responsible reproduction and regular animal examinations are crucial for a long duration. They can be sensitive and require a kind caretaker.
